Cost of Living: Apalachicola, FL vs Tuscaloosa, AL

Housing

The housing market plays a significant role in determining the cost of living.

Metric Apalachicola Tuscaloosa
Housing Index 95.0 90.0
Median Home Price $150,000 $249,900
Average Rent (2 BR Apartment) $1500 $950
Average Rent (2 BR House) $1565 $1000

Housing Comparison: Apalachicola vs Tuscaloosa

  • The median home price in Tuscaloosa is higher at $249,900, compared to $150,000 in Apalachicola.
  • In Tuscaloosa, the rental for a two-bedroom apartment stands at $950, while it is $1,500 in Apalachicola.

Utilities

The cost of utilities such as electricity, natural gas, and other services can significantly impact the overall cost of living.

Metric Apalachicola Tuscaloosa
Electricity Price $13.89 $15.03
Natural Gas Price $26.13 $21.76
Other Utilities $200 $200

Utilities Comparison: Apalachicola vs Tuscaloosa

  • Tuscaloosa has higher electricity costs at $15.03 per kWh, versus $13.89 in Apalachicola.
  • Natural gas is more expensive in Apalachicola at $26.13 per unit, while it is cheaper at $21.76 in Tuscaloosa.
  • Utility expenses are equal in both Apalachicola and Tuscaloosa averaging $200.
